摘要
针对船舶操纵模拟器对船舶启动状态研究的需求,以开源工具OSG作为船舶航行模拟器的软件开发平台,以7000DWT油轮的推进装置和舵为研究对象,进行运动模型数学建模,利用MultiGen Creator建立船舶及地理场景模型,并利用OSG各个工作空间功能,对上述模型进行加载,构成临近环境要素。设计运动函数实现船舶从静止至到达额定航速的加减速、转舵和正倒车操作,用MFC对开发的系统进行封装,实现对虚拟船舶驾驶及周边视景的控制,并结合Matlab为船舶航行驾驶模拟器的开发提供一种新的解决方案。
According to requirements of ship maneuvering simulator for research of ship's starting, with OSG as the platform for ship navigation simulator development, this essay studies the propulsion system and rudder of 7,000dwt oil tankers through mathematical modeling, and uses MultiGen Creator to build ship and geographic models, which were loaded by C + + programming function called OSG. MFC is used to conceal the system, so as to control the simulated ship navigation and the sceneries all around. Meanwhile, Matlab is used to provide a solution for development of ship navigation simulator.
出处
《武汉船舶职业技术学院学报》
2013年第2期16-19,共4页
Journal of Wuhan Institute of Shipbuilding Technology